Situated in the prestigious Russian Hill-Vallejo Street Crest Historic District, the property offers breathtaking, multi-level views of the Bay Bridge, Downtown, and the East Bay.
The home underwent a comprehensive 2022-2025 renovation that seamlessly integrates 1909 Albert Farr historic character with high-end modern finishes, an elevator, and a flexible floor plan.
The oversized 6,599 sqft lot features a rare 'Secret Garden' and provides four-car parking (two-car garage plus two-car driveway), a significant luxury in a dense urban neighborhood.
Living area discrepancy between mls listing and other public or private record. mls listing living area = 4405, other record living area = 3073.
While currently occupied as a single-family residence, the property is legally classified as two units, which may complicate financing or require specific buyer due diligence.
Located within a celebrated historic district, any future exterior modifications or structural changes are subject to strict architectural review and preservation guidelines.
Secret Garden Estate & Spectacular Views on Russian Hill! Tranquil, secluded, and light-filled - this completely detached garden retreat rests on a hillside in San Francisco's celebrated Russian Hill-Vallejo Street Crest Historic District, offering views from every level, whether sweeping vistas of downtown, the Bay Bridge, and the East Bay or verdant garden views. Originally designed in 1909 by renowned architect Albert Farr in the First Bay Area Tradition, the home was beautifully restored and renovated from 2022-2025, blending historic character with exquisite materials and craftsmanship within a flexible, modern floor plan: five bedrooms, four and a half baths, a kitchen/great room, formal living/dining room, private office, and a media/au pair suite - all set on an extraordinary 48' x 137.5' lot. On each level, decks and/or lush, terraced gardens provide the indoor-outdoor lifestyle so coveted today. Two-car garage plus additional two-car parking in front of the garage. Elevator from the garage to the 1st and 3rd Floors. Legally two units, though occupied today as a single-family residence. A rare opportunity to own one of Russian Hill's most storied addresses.
